My son is 14 months old and has been attending Bright Horizons at Tulane since he was about 6 months old. First off, he absolutely loves it. Ms. Denise is the only person outside of our family that he actually reaches for. We get picture and/or video updates almost every day, which are delightful. They track everything from naps to meals to diaper changes in the app. The staff is just wonderful. I've never had a bad experience with any of them and everyone knows my son's name and says hello to him. Of course, incidents like falling or getting mildly hurt are inevitable. If something happens, they call me immediately to let me know. Same goes for if he gets sick during the day, which has thankfully only happened once. They take COVID precautions very seriously! Masks are required for adults at all times, there's a symptom checker you have to fill out in the app every morning, and temperature of the child and anyone accompanying them is taken at drop-off. If a family reports a COVID exposure, the entire class is closed for the quarantine period, which makes it much less likely to be passed around. If a child is diagnosed with RSV, all families in that class get an alert. I was honestly terrified to send my child to daycare in the middle of a pandemic but I genuinely feel that he is safe here. We live in Metairie, I work in Elmwood, and my husband works Uptown (we both work for Tulane). We drive 20-30 minutes to drop our son off and pick him up. It's worth the distance. It's worth the price, which is admittedly quite high. I wholeheartedly recommend BH to any local families who have the means to send their kids here.

I would recommend Bright Horizons to any parent looking to place their kid in an educational and caring child care program. My child has been attending at this location since they were 10 months old, so for about 2 years now. She has moved through 3 stages/age groups and each one has been great. She is bringing home new words and songs everyday, she knows how to count to 10, and all her ABCs. The teachers are hands-on and really seem care about your child's well being. I appreciate their approach to teaching children, and I have really seen the benefits and growth in my child. When COVID hit, we were as nervous as any parent would be about continuing to send her to school. But, this center has been clear about the guidelines and immediately made changes to the pick-up drop-off procedures; making sure everyone is safe. I feel comfortable continuing to send my child to daycare. This has also helped her to interact with her peers and make relationships with other adults besides her family. The center uses the Bright Horizons app which allows parents to receive updates throughout the day. The updates can include: when your child eats, gets changed/uses the potty, or sleeps. There are also always a bunch of daily photos and videos of the days activities.
